How much do entry level admin j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 25,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level admin in Rhode Island is $19.53,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.01 and $21.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ry level admin?

Entry level admin jobs are positions that provide administrative support within an organization and are suitable for individuals with little to no prior experience in administration. These roles typically involve tasks such as answering phones, scheduling appointments, filing documents, data entry, and assisting other staff members with daily office operations. Entry level admin jobs are ideal for those seeking to develop organizational, communication, and computer skills while gaining experience in a professional environment. These positions can serve as stepping stones to more advanced administrative or office management ro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level admin?

To thrive as an Entry Level Admin, you need strong organizational skills, basic office management knowledge, and proficiency in written and verbal communication, usually sup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with office software like Microsoft Office Suite, email platforms, and sometimes basic database systems is typically required. Attention to detail, reliability, and a proactive attitude help individuals excel in supporting teams and handling multiple tasks. These skills are crucial for ensuring smooth office operations, maintaining accurate records, and contributing to overall workplace efficiency.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level admin professionals, and how can they overcome them?

Entry-level admin professionals often encounter challenges such as managing competing priorities, adapting to fast-paced environments, and learning new office technologies. To overcome these, it's helpful to develop strong organizational skills, communicate proactively with supervisors, and seek out training or mentorship on software tools commonly used in the workplace. Building good relationships with coworkers and asking for clarification when unsure can also ease the transition and help you become a confident, valued team member.

Can I work in an entry level admin with no experience?

Entry level administrative assistant positions often do not require prior experience and focus on basic skills such as organization, communication, and familiarity with office software like Microsoft Office. Employers may provide on-the-job training, making it possible for candidates with little or no experience to qualify for these roles.

How to become an entry level admin with no experience?

To become an entry-level admin, focus on developing basic skills in office software like Microsoft Office, organization, and communication. Gaining relevant certifications such as an administrative assistant or office management course can improve your chances, and internships or volunteer work can provide practical experience.

How to start a career in entry level admin?

To start a career as an entry-level admin, gain basic office skills such as data entry, organization, and communication. Obtain relevant experience through internships or volunteer work, and become familiar with common tools like Microsoft Office or Google Workspace. A high school diploma is typically required, and strong organizational skills are essential for success in this role.
